Job Description:
We are seeking a Machine Operator who performs and supports the operations and production of the plant, but not limited to the operations of the stranding department assuring that area meets all federal and local regulations. They will primarily monitor the rewinding process assuring safe operation and production of packs of strand that meets the posted quality requirements. Additionally, they will monitor the stranding process to assist the foreman with spool changes and wire breaks. The Machine Operator must be able to perform all jobs as the Strander in case of the absence of the shift lead.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Performs daily overhead crane check sheet prior to start of process and ensures safe operation of their crane and all equipment used in the stranding/rewinding process.
- Re-strand machine as necessary.
- Perform QC inspections of products as necessary.
- Support production and customer demand at all times.

- Must be able to read micrometer and properly measure strand and wire diameter and calculate strand pitch.
- Must be able to make a strand lay direction change at the strander.
- Must be able to operate hand and power tools.
- Must be able to load size recipes for both the strander and the rewinder operator station.
- Must be able to install the proper guide plates on the rewinder drum for the size being produced.
- Must be able to zero the traverse and make the proper decisions on adjustment of the traverse and plates if needed.
- Must be able to properly cut the wire off the spools at the end of a run.
- Must be able to safely remove, strip and load spools using an overhead crane during strander spool changes.
- Must be able to monitor the strander/rewinder machinery while in production of wire and report any problems to the shift lead/supervisor.
- Must be able to repair a wire break at any location from the spool to the take up of the drawing machine.
- Must be able to understand the wire layering diagram and use it for the proper layering and routing of the wire through the strander.
- Must be able to perform all QC tests of the strand (BS Test).
- Must be able to properly fill out and understand a Strand IR form.
- Must be able to properly pull the strand off a full take up cut it and swap take ups.
- Must be able to properly thread the strand through all rollers on the rewinder and strander dancers.
- Must be able to handle wire and strand ends safely and understand the torsion of wire and strand and how it should be dealt with if encountered.
